Application I of Khellin is primarily seen in the pharmaceutical industry, where it is valued for its therapeutic potential. It has been identified as a promising compound for treating various ailments such as asthma, cardiovascular issues, and inflammatory diseases. Khellin is used in formulating medicines and therapies that aim to improve respiratory health by acting as a bronchodilator. The pharmaceutical application of Khellin has sparked interest among researchers and pharmaceutical companies due to its effectiveness in enhancing the efficacy of other compounds, making it an essential component in certain drug formulations. 1. What is Khellin used for?
Khellin is used in pharmaceuticals, cosmetics, agriculture, and biotechnology, with applications ranging from respiratory treatments to skin care and natural pest control.
2. Is Khellin safe for use in cosmetics?
Yes, Khellin is considered safe for use in cosmetics, especially in skin care products due to its anti-inflammatory and circulation-boosting properties.
3. Can Khellin help with asthma?
Yes, Khellin is known for its potential to act as a bronchodilator, which can help alleviate symptoms of asthma by improving airflow to the lungs.
4. Is Khellin a natural product?
Yes, Khellin is derived from the plant genus Ammi, making it a natural compound used in various industries.
